Accused flim-flam artist arrested in Richmond County


web posted December 15, 2007
EDGEFIELD – The prolific flim-flam artist wanted across Edgefield County has been arrested Friday night, Edgefield County Sheriff’s Chief Investigator Randy Doran said early Saturday morning. “They (Richmond County Sheriff’s Deputies) picked him up on a traffic stop Friday night.” Tyrone Eugene Reid, 40, of Augusta, Georgia was reportedly still being held in Augusta Richmond County due to several warrants from Edgefield County, Edgefield, Johnston, and Saluda.

Inv. Doran said that they were hoping to have Mr. Reid brought to Edgefield County to face the pending charges and he would be meeting with the Solicitor’s Office on Monday to make that happen.

Reid is accused of a series of flim-flams in Edgefield County where he gives a cashier a $100 bill and then claims to be short-changed after swapping $20 bills given in change by the cashier with $1 bills he keeps in his left hand. Though dozens of incidents have been reported, only seven have been formally charged by local law enforcement agencies.

The most recent report came on Wednesday when Reid was suspected in a similar scam at the Wal-Mart on Richland Avenue in Aiken.

It is unknown if Aiken County has open or pending warrants on Mr. Reid.
